Rangefinders

A rangefinder is one of the most useful accessories you can buy. It measures the distance to the flag, allowing you to know exactly how far you are from the hole. This information is invaluable for club selection. Laser rangefinders are most common and provide accurate distances. GPS watches are another option that shows distances to various points on the hole.

Golf Watches

Golf watches provide GPS distances and often include additional features like scorecard tracking and hazard information. They're convenient because they're always on your wrist. Modern golf watches are accurate and reliable, though they require charging between rounds.

Alignment Aids

Alignment aids help you aim properly at your target. These might include alignment sticks for practice or alignment marks on your putter. Proper alignment is crucial for consistent golf, and these tools help you develop good alignment habits.

Other Useful Accessories

Other accessories include golf balls (obviously), tees, ball markers, divot repair tools, towels, and golf bags. A good golf bag should be comfortable to carry or easy to push on a cart, and it should have enough pockets to organize your gear.
